在一次真实案例中,iPhone用户A在打开TP Wallet时频繁闪退。本文以该案例为线索,给出诊断与改进建议,并从区块生成、EOS机制、用户友好界面与未来市场切入高效能数字科技的行业洞悉。
先讲https://www.hbhtfy.net ,排查流程:确认iOS与TP Wallet版本兼容性,检查应用权限、后台刷新与网络,清理缓存或卸载重装,必要时用助记词/私钥离线恢复钱包。若问题仍在,采集崩溃日志(用Xcode或手机诊断),在另一台设备和不同网络上复现以隔离环境变量。实践中,应先复现场景→收集日志→隔离变量→切换RPC/节点→回归测试→优化重试与内存管理→灰度上线监测。
从区块链交互角度看,EOS采用DPoS的区块生成方式,确认节点出块频率与RPC健康度至关重要。公共节点在高峰或网络抖动时会出现超时或返回异常数据,客户端若未做超时保护或在主线程完成大量解析,会导致界面卡顿甚至崩溃。解决办法包括切换可靠RPC、实现请求重试与指数退避、将签名与序列化移出UI主线程、引入请求队列与限流。
举例:在该案例中,将默认公共RPC换成付费主节点并把签名逻辑放入后台队列后,闪退率显著下降;加入CPU/NET/ RAM查询并在交易前提示用户抵押资源,也有效避免了因资源不足导致的异常。用户友好界面应提供渐进式错误提示、事务队列可视化、操作回滚与明确的恢复路径,让非专业用户也能理解何时需要补足资源或切换节点。
未来市场应用要求钱包既能满足高吞吐链的即时确认,又要兼容跨链、Layer2与游戏、DeFi等场景。技术方向包括轻量验证、链下签名批量广播、与去中心化身份(DID)及现实世界资产桥接。行业洞悉表明:节点稳定性、严格安全审计、多重备份与清晰的恢复流程,是提升用户留存与市场竞争力的核心。


总结来说,TP Wallet在iPhone上闪退通常是多因子叠加的结果:客户端资源管理、RPC节点健康、交易签名与主线程阻塞、以及产品层的提示不足。系统化的排错与针对EOS特性的工程与产品优化,能把闪退问题转化为提升体验与扩展市场的机会。
评论
Mia
实用的排错流程,换节点这步我没想到,马上试试。
张强
关于把签名移出主线程的实践很有价值,开发团队应参考。
CryptoFan88
补充一点:遇到闪退也要注意检查助记词备份,否则恢复会很麻烦。
小米
喜欢文章结尾的观点,把技术问题做成产品优势非常到位。